What Defines a True Open World Game?
An open-world game allows players to tackle content out of sequence giving room for creativity exploration and personal pacing choices unlike linear counterparts which lock objectives to set story points. It includes vast digital spaces rich with lore environmental storytelling and interactive side quests.

Technical Evolution – From Pixels to Immersive Universes
Gaming used to mean small boxed territories confined within invisible borders but as technology progressed developers were finally empowered to deliver sprawling worlds. Think about what modern graphics APIs and multi-core processors allow – seamless streaming of vast terrains dynamic foliage physics realistic sky gradients all in one screen without loading interruptions.
